Caretaker: Average Salary in Canada, 2026
Find out what the average Caretaker salary is
Salary rate
How much does a Caretaker make in Canada?
$44,850/ Annual
Based on 3892 salaries
Based on 3892 salaries
The average Caretaker in Canada is $44,850 per year or $23 per hour. Entry-level positions start at $42,218 per year, while most experienced workers make up to $50,020 per year.
Median$44,850

Low$42,218
High$50,020
Caretaker: Average Salary in Canada
Quebec$44,109
British Columbia$43,661
Nova Scotia$41,652
Alberta$41,574
Saskatchewan$40,892
Active jobs with salaries